The Clifford tori in constitute a one-parameter family of flat, two-dimensional, constant mean curvature (CMC) submanifolds. This paper demonstrates that new, topologically non-trivial CMC surfaces resembling a pair of neighbouring Clifford tori connected at a sub-lattice consisting of at least two points by small catenoidal bridges can be constructed by perturbative PDE methods. For a bounded linear operator T in a Banach space the Ritt resolvent condition (|λ| > 1) can be extended (changing the constant C) to any sector |arg(λ - 1)| ≤ π - δ, . This implies the power boundedness of the operator T. A key result is that the spectrum σ(T) is contained in a special convex closed domain. A generalized Ritt condition leads to a similar localization result and then to a theorem on invariant subspaces.
